Chicane

DrawPolyResource

ヘッダー
Includes/Chicane/Renderer/Draw/Poly/Resource.hpp
ネームスペース
Chicane::Renderer::DrawPolyResource

Types

名前価値説明
Map
std::unordered_map<DrawPolyTypeDrawPolyResource>
Draws
std::unordered_map<StringDrawPoly>

関数

アクセスタイプモディファイア名前説明
public
bool
const
isEmpty()
public
const  Draws&
const
getDraws()
public
const  Vertex::List&
const
getVertices()
public
const
getIndices()
public
findId(
const  DrawPolyData& inData
)
public
findId(
const  Draw::Reference& inReference
)
public
const  DrawPoly&
getDraw(
const  Draw::Reference& inReference
)
public
const  DrawPoly&
getDraw(
Draw::Id inId
)
public
add(
const  DrawPolyData& inData
)
public
void
reset()
private
const
generateInternalReference(
DrawPolyMode inMode
Draw::Id inId
)

メンバ

アクセスタイプモディファイア名前説明
private
m_draws
private
m_vertices
private
m_indices